Leveraging AI for Customer
Insight
AI's
ability to process and analyze large datasets allows entrepreneurs to uncover
patterns and trends that were previously difficult to identify. For instance,
sentiment analysis tools can analyze customer feedback from various sources,
such as social media, reviews, and surveys, to gauge overall sentiment toward a
brand or product. This analysis can reveal hidden pain points and areas for
improvement, helping businesses refine their strategies.
An
example of this is the use of Lexalytics, a sentiment analysis platform that
enables companies to parse through vast amounts of text data and understand
customer emotions. A startup in the e-commerce space used Lexalytics to analyze
customer reviews and discovered that delivery speed was a major concern. Armed
with this insight, the company revamped its logistics to offer faster delivery
options, leading to increased customer satisfaction and sales.
Customizing the Customer
Experience
AI
can also help entrepreneurs personalize the customer experience.
Personalization engines, such as Dynamic Yield, use AI to analyze customer
behavior and preferences, enabling businesses to deliver tailored content and
recommendations. This approach not only enhances the customer experience but
also drives engagement and loyalty.
For
example, a digital marketing agency utilized Dynamic Yield to optimize its
clients' websites. By analyzing user behavior, the agency could offer
personalized content recommendations, resulting in a 20% increase in conversion
rates for its clients. This demonstrates how AI-driven personalization can lead
to significant business growth.
Case Study: Enhancing
Customer Engagement
A
compelling case study involves Ritual, a health-focused brand that uses AI to
connect with its customers. Ritual employs an AI-powered chatbot to provide
personalized supplement recommendations based on individual health goals and
dietary preferences. By gathering data through interactions with the chatbot,
Ritual can continually refine its product offerings and marketing strategies.
This personalized approach has helped the company build a loyal customer base
and increase its market share.
The Future of AI in
Entrepreneurship
As
AI technology advances, its potential applications in entrepreneurship will
continue to expand. One emerging area is the rapid prototyping of ideas. AI
tools like OpenAI's Codex can assist non-technical entrepreneurs in developing
software prototypes by converting natural language descriptions into code. This
capability democratizes access to technology, enabling more entrepreneurs to
bring their ideas to life.
In
the realm of physical products, AI-powered design tools like DeepArt can
transform text descriptions into visual representations, allowing entrepreneurs
to visualize and iterate on product concepts quickly. This capability shortens
the product development cycle and facilitates innovation.
